Default Shoe size?

So I am a big shoe freak. I mean I love shoes... but since I have been over weight I dont get to buy the shoes I like all that often unless I want to pay 2 or 3 times as much. I am wondering if anyone on this board had a significant change in show size after they lost thier weight? May seem like a stupid question.. and I have several more .... but this is the one that popped into my mind this morning... any resposes are appreciated.

Default Shoe Size

Hi Amandazon,

I think some people do have a change in shoe size. I am only 4 weeks post op so I am not sure what will happen to me this time, but in the past when I was able to lose weight on my own (about 80 pounds that I kept off for, oh, 10 minutes before gaining it all back plus some) my shoe size changed about a half to one whole size, depending on the style of the shoe. I think this will vary for everyone depending on body type and how you lose, but don't be suprised if you do find yourself in smaller sizes from head to toe! Losing weight is so much fun!!!
